Abstract

Generative development techniques are considered as a proper mean to increase efficiency in software development. We applied different generative techniques to create software from abstract specifications. Foundational cornerstone of all approaches is the generation of source code from domain knowledge. We applied run-time generation of data model, user interface generation from XML Schema and domain specific language during the development of different software prototypes in the domain of electrical engineering. In this paper we report on and compare the application of these different approaches and discuss their applicability in the presented industrial context.
